How much do Duke Law graduates make?

Duke University School of Law came in third with grads earning an average salary of $202,254 four years post-graduation—the last school on the list with an average salary topping $200,000. Two years post-grad, Duke Law alumni earn an average salary of $168,098, the second highest salary nationwide after two years.

Who is the highest paid employee at Duke University?

A total of 14 Duke employees earned more than $1 million, with five earning more than $2 million. Former Duke men's basketball head coach Mike Krzyzewski, who is a current ambassador to the University, topped the list at $7.4 million.

How much does 1 year at Duke cost?

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

In 2022-23, Duke University tuition was $62,688, 4.1% higher than the previous year. Total cost of attendance was $82,749. In the same year, the average total cost for a private four-year university was $57,570.
